When you budget for new windows, several factors change the final number. The material you choose—like vinyl, wood, or fiberglass—is usually the biggest driver. You will also see price shifts based on the style of window, such as double-hung versus large picture windows, and the specific energy-efficiency ratings you select. The size of the opening and the complexity of the installation, especially if the existing frames need repair, will also adjust the total. We determine the exact pricing confirmed free on the call.
This service covers the end-to-end process of upgrading your home's windows. You should look into this if your windows are difficult to open, fogging up between the panes, or if your energy bills have started climbing due to poor insulation. Professional services ensure that the sizing is accurate and the installation follows local building codes. They handle the heavy lifting, debris removal, and the final weather-stripping to make sure your home stays comfortable throughout the seasons.

Basement window installation in San Jose involves creating an opening in the foundation wall to fit a new window. This process requires careful excavation and ensuring proper waterproofing and drainage around the new unit.
